PEOPLE v. SCHULTZ


161 A.D.2d 970 (1990)

The People of the State of New York, Respondent, v. John J. Schultz,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Third Department.

May 24, 1990


Weiss, J.

On November 23, 1988 during the course of investigating recent burglaries in the City of Elmira, Chemung County, the police obtained a sworn statement by Alyson Barrett implicating defendant in a series of burglaries and larcenies. The police were informed that defendant was about to depart by bus for New York City.
